Abstract
A remotely controllable rescue vessel is provided that includes: a rigid lower hull portion; an inflatable upper hull portion coupled to the rigid lower portion; and a remotely controllable motor, configurable to drive the remotely controllable rescue vessel according to remote instructions.
Claims
exact text as granted — not AI-modified1 . A remotely controllable rescue vessel including:
a rigid lower hull portion; an inflatable upper hull portion coupled to the rigid lower portion; and a remotely controllable motor, configurable to drive the remotely controllable rescue vessel according to remote instructions.
2 . The remotely controllable rescue vessel of claim 1 , wherein the remotely controllable rescue vessel is self-righting in water.
3 . The remotely controllable rescue vessel of claim 1 , wherein the inflatable upper hull portion includes a tube member extending upwardly and across a width of the hull, to cause the vessel to roll back to an upright position.
4 . The remotely controllable rescue vessel of claim 3 , wherein the inflatable upper hull portion include a further tube member, to support the tube member.
5 . The remotely controllable rescue vessel of claim 4 , wherein the further tube member is coupled to the tube member at a right angle.
6 . The remotely controllable rescue vessel of claim 1 , wherein the inflatable upper hull portion includes a tubular collar extending around at least part of a periphery of the rigid lower hull portion.
7 . The remotely controllable rescue vessel of claim 1 , wherein the inflatable upper hull portion is defined by a plurality of interconnected tubular members.
8 . The remotely controllable rescue vessel of claim 7 , wherein the interconnected tubular members are fluidly connected such that they may be inflated simultaneously.
9 . The remotely controllable rescue vessel of claim 1 , wherein the vessel includes a compressed gas (e.g. carbon dioxide) cylinder configured to fill the inflatable upper hull portion.
10 . The remotely controllable rescue vessel of claim 1 , wherein the vessel includes a propeller, coupled to the motor, and a shroud, for shrouding the propeller.
11 . The remotely controllable rescue vessel of claim 10 , further including a rudder, provided in association with the propeller, for guiding the vessel, wherein operation of the motor and the rudder may be remotely controllable.
12 . The remotely controllable rescue vessel of claim 1 , wherein the rigid lower hull portion comprise a planing hull in the form of a V-shaped or modified V-shaped hull.
13 . The remotely controllable rescue vessel of claim 1 , wherein the motor is battery powered, and wherein the battery is housed in the rigid lower hull portion.
14 . The remotely controllable rescue vessel of claim 1 , wherein the lower rigid hull portion defines an enclosed space, wherein the enclosed space is watertight and includes a removable watertight hatch.
15 . The remotely controllable rescue vessel of claim 1 including an intake, for receiving water, for cooling components in the enclosed space in use.
16 . The remotely controllable rescue vessel of claim 1 including attachment members on the inflatable upper hull portion, the attachment members configured to releasably receive accessories or attachments of the vessel.
17 . The remotely controllable rescue vessel of claim 1 configured to receive signals from a beacon, and navigate autonomously to the beacon according to the beacon signal.
18 . The remotely controllable rescue vessel of claim 1 , wherein the beacon comprises an AIS beacon that forms part of a life jacket.
19 . The remotely controllable rescue vessel of claim 1 , further include sensors to capture data.
